The totitle function converts a string to title case, capitalizing the first character. Use this function to format display strings, normalize names, or create human-readable output from log data.

Usage

Syntax

totitle(value)

Parameters

Name Type Required Description
value string Yes The input string to convert to title case.

Returns

Returns the input string with the first character capitalized.

Use case examples

Format HTTP methods and status codes for human-readable reports.

Query

['sample-http-logs']
| extend formatted_method = totitle(tolower(method))
| summarize request_count = count() by formatted_method, status
| sort by request_count desc
| limit 10

Run in Playground

Output

formatted_method status request_count
Get 200 5432
Post 201 2341
Get 404 1987

This query formats HTTP methods in title case, making reports and dashboards more professional and easier to read.

Format service names for display in monitoring dashboards.

Query

['otel-demo-traces']
| extend display_name = totitle(['service.name'])
| summarize span_count = count(), avg_duration = avg(duration) by display_name
| sort by span_count desc
| limit 10

Run in Playground

Output

display_name span_count avg_duration
Frontend 4532 125ms
Checkout 3421 234ms
Cart 2987 89ms

This query formats service names in title case for cleaner presentation in monitoring dashboards and reports.
